As far as I knew the Lloyds Classic Plus account had two conditions to get the full interest rate - pay in £1,000 a month and log in to your online account a couple of times a month.
Looking at the conditions today though online I could see no mention of the "login twice a month" thingie. Have they scrapped that part? Are there any other conditions you have to meet?
I'm trying to figure out why my latest monthly interest payment was for 49p (net), when I usually get about seven quid...

The conditions changed last year (or even earlier?), only condition is £1000pm must be credited to account.
If you call or pop into a branch they will change you to the new plus offer of 6% for 12m.:beer:0 -
According to the websiteYou’ll need to pay in at least £1,000 each month and use Internet Banking regularly.
I've had one of these accounts for some years now. My experience is that they are not particularly strict about the £1000pm and as long as you have their internet banking option, that seems to be considered regular enough
Interest is 6% for new applicants or 4% or older customers. Both is limited to the initial £2500. 0.1% applies to amounts thereafter, the same that applies to all amounts on the classic account.
To get £7 interest at 4% would need an average balance of £2100
£2100 at 0.1% would give interest of 17p
To get £7 interest at 6% would need an average balance of £1400
£1400 at 0.1% would give interest of 12p
(all values gross)
Sorry, no idea why you have only received 49p net interest this month, other than your average balance over the month was not what you usually have. The new deal of 6% is available to both old and new customers.
Old customers have to ask for it though it is not automatic.0 -
jonesMUFCforever wrote: »The new deal of 6% is available to both old and new customers.
Old customers have to ask for it though it is not automatic.
Correct. I phoned customer services (Phonebank Direct) a few weeks ago & I now have the 6% interest rate for 12 months.0 -
